Beckett, Gulbahar H.; Stiefvater, Andrea – TESL Canada Journal, 2009
This article discusses the findings of an ethnographic study that explored the perceptions of ESL graduate students toward non-native English-Speaker Teachers (NNESTs) in the United States, a little researched topic. Shi, Ling; Beckett, Gulbahar H. – TESL Canada Journal, 2002
Investigated the learning experiences of 23 Japanese students in a one-year academic exchange program in a Canadian university. Participants either wrote an opinion task or a summary task at the beginning of the program using preselected source texts.
